Vancouver Canucks hire Manny Malhotra as head coach
Summary

The Vancouver Canucks announced Manny Malhotra as their new head coach on June 1, 2026. Malhotra steps into the role following the firing of Adam Foote, aiming to cultivate a strong team culture. General Manager Ryan Johnson highlighted Malhotra's experience and ability to develop young talent as critical for the rebuilding team, which has struggled in recent years. Malhotra previously coached the AHL's Abbotsford Canucks, leading them to their first Calder Cup. His mandate now includes improving the team's environment and instilling non-negotiable professional standards among players.
